关于redis分布式和分布式锁

来源:14-1 Spring Schedule+Redis分布式锁构建分布式任务调度概述

乃好

2019-08-21

老师你好,请问如果不做redis分布式是不是也是可以实现锁的功能呢?我个人觉得可以,因为锁的核心是setnx是否能成功,那这个和分布式与否应该没有关系吧?

如果说不需要redis分布式也可以实现锁,那么为什么要叫分布式锁呢?还是说因为这里是在redis分布式基础上实现的锁所以叫分布式锁?如果不是分布式是不是可以直接称为锁?

写回答

1回答

geelylucky

2019-08-21

和redis是否分布式没有任何关系,使用mysql也可以实现分布式锁,zookeeper也可以实现分布式锁。针对于多个应用抢占同一个资源进行锁限制,可以称为分布式锁。分布式锁属于锁的其中一种。

0
1
乃好
?~~~
2019-08-21
共1条回复

Java企业级电商项目架构 Tomcat集群与Redis分布式

Tomcat集群+Redis分布式+代码重构+源码原理解析

2675 学习 · 947 问题

查看课程